Household of Jacobus Wagemans

He is married to Jacomina Maltha.

They got married on May 11, 1843 at Schiedam (ZH), he was 52 years old.Source 2


Child(ren):

  1. Maria Wagemans  1838-????
  2. Jacoba Wagemans  1841-????
  3. Arnoldina Wagemans  1844-????
  4. Johanna Wagemans  1847-????
  5. Petronella Wagemans  1847-????
  6. Jacomina Wagemans  1851-1917
